In my long career in which plants, over 70 at one point, used #6 fuel oil for the boilers, I never encountered or even heard of an explosion. As a matter of fact, #6 fuel was totally trouble free. When it got so expensive, installations were made so we could switch to natural gas. We freely switched out and back, depending on which had a lower cost at the time.

I don't know about now, but in the '60's,'70,s and '80's there were hundreds and hundreds of plant boilers that used 36 fuel oil all over the US, and I suppose the world.

We did not like to switch to natural gas.
